## Local setup

Hey, welcome aboard! The Queuestretch autoscaler watches queue depth and nudges worker counts up or down. To run it locally, install deps with `make setup`, then start the fake broker with `make broker`. The scaler needs somewhere to store scaling decisions, so point it at the dev database using the connection string below.

primary connection of yagep-kahip = redis://giliel_svc:zYiKsLL2PLpfPL@db-348f.xolmarsys.corp:5432/fenwyn

2024-11 rotation — FareLattice rules engine. The previous signing key for fee-rule bundles was retired after reaching its scheduled 12-month lifetime; no compromise is suspected. All rule packs published since the cutover are signed with the replacement key, and the verifier now rejects the old fingerprint. Audit logs covering the rotation window were archived for review. Reviewers validating shipping-fee bundle signatures should pin the new key, reproduced below for convenience.

deploy key for kajof-yawif: bky9_fvxrpdHPq

# BranchSweeper: automated stale-branch cleanup for the Lintwood monorepo.
# The bot scans remote branches nightly, flags anything with no commits past
# the staleness window, and opens a deletion proposal instead of deleting
# outright. Branches matching protected patterns are always skipped, as are
# branches with open merge requests. Maintainers on the Pellerin team tuned
# these values after the March sweep removed too aggressively; adjust with
# care and update the runbook. The tuning constants are as follows.

tuning constants:
QUOTAS = {
    "druwyn": 5,
    "holix": 5,
    "zorath": 5,
    "holwyn": 10,
}